Xiaomi & Mijia: The Smart Space Masters

Xiaomi and its sub-brand Mijia dominate the smart home market with products designed for efficiency. From air purifiers to foldable e-bikes, their gear is built for small-space living.

Take the Mijia Air Purifier 4: it covers up to 48m² on just 28W power, perfect for studio apartments. Or the Xiaomi Compact Washing Machine, weighing only 10kg and fitting under most countertops—ideal for laundry nooks.

Huawei AI Living: Seamless Integration

Huawei’s AI Cube and Solar Inverter Kits bring energy-smart solutions to compact homes. Their ecosystem allows full voice and app control over lighting, climate, and security—all through a single interface.

In 2023, Huawei reported that users of their smart home systems saw an average 18% reduction in energy consumption, a huge win for eco-conscious city residents.

Why China Leads in Compact Design

High urban density drives innovation. With over 60% of China’s population living in cities, demand for space-efficient tech and furniture is massive. Brands respond with R&D focused on minimal footprint, maximum function.

Add in rapid prototyping, low production costs, and a culture embracing digital integration, and you’ve got a perfect storm for smart compact living.
